<h3><span style="font-weight: 400;">Investing in energy-efficient renovations</span></h3>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Investing in energy-efficient renovations is a great strategy to improve your sustainable living environment while decreasing your power bills.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">LED lighting consumes far less energy than old bulbs. Switching to LED lighting saves 75% on energy and lasts 25 times longer than standard bulbs, lowering replacement costs. Energy-efficient appliances can reduce usage by up to 30%, saving money and resources.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Also, try smart temperature control. Installing smart thermostats helps you optimize heating and cooling by altering temperatures according to your schedule, avoiding wasted energy.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Then, </span><a href="https://doi.org/10.1007/978-3-030-86884-0_9" target="_blank" rel="noopener"><span style="font-weight: 400;">install solar panels</span></a><span style="font-weight: 400;"> to collect renewable energy. Solar power minimizes reliance on nonrenewable energy and increases the value of your property by investing in a cleaner future.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Specifically, installing solar panels could decrease your power cost by 50-70% while creating sustainable energy and minimizing carbon impact. Combining solar panels with other modifications creates a living space that reduces waste, power expenses, and carbon impact.</span></p>

<h3><span style="font-weight: 400;">Adopting eco-friendly habits</span></h3>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Environmentally friendly practices are critical for building a sustainable living environment that encourages a greener lifestyle.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Begin by decreasing water waste; simple steps such as repairing leaks, taking shorter showers, and cleaning roads with a brush rather than a hose can have a major impact.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Incorporating sustainable lifestyle examples, such as appropriate recycling and reusable items like cloth bags and stainless steel water bottles, helps reduce waste. Also, consider using eco-friendly cleaning products from natural components or air-drying your garments to conserve electricity.</span></p>

<h3><span style="font-weight: 400;">Decluttering and organizing for sustainability</span></h3>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Organizing for sustainability is an effective way to create a sustainable living space that promotes a greener lifestyle.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Begin by decluttering your home. Empowering minimalism helps you evaluate what you genuinely require and enjoy. Instead of dumping stuff, try donating or reusing it to give new life to useless items.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Also, use storage options from recycled materials, such as baskets woven from recovered fibers or bins manufactured from repurposed plastics.</span></p>

<h3><span style="font-weight: 400;">Implementing sustainable household management</span></h3>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">This entails making conscious decisions to eliminate waste, save resources, and promote a healthy ecosystem. By implementing sustainable practices, you lay the groundwork for a healthy living environment and a lifestyle consistent with long-term ecological objectives.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Begin by implementing waste-reduction devices, such as a compost bin for kitchen leftovers, improving your garden, and lowering landfill inputs. Then, invest in energy-efficient equipment that reduces your electricity costs, as detailed above.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-weight: 400;">Additionally, purchasing </span><a href="https://doi.org/10.1007/s41130-021-00148-w" target="_blank" rel="noopener"><span style="font-weight: 400;">locally sourced</span></a><span style="font-weight: 400;">, sustainable products and going to farmers&#8217; markets supports local agriculture while lowering transportation emissions. Choosing things with minimum packaging minimizes waste and helps to keep landfills free of unneeded materials.
